Boyer's early books are dominated by the theme of the heroic quest.īoyer attended Brigham Young University where she studied English literature and Scandinavian mythology. Boyer tended to follow the Norse versions of these story elements closely without much deviation. Her stories are characterized by light and dark elves, dwarves, trolls, sorcerers, ley lines, burial mounds, wizards, and so forth. While Norse mythology has been an influence on the fantasy genre, and many authors such as Tolkien and Lewis were influenced by these myths, Boyer's books followed them much more closely. Her stories were deeply influenced by Norse mythology, and are set in a fantasy world whose climate and geography resembles that of the Scandinavia of Norse myths. Elizabeth Boyer is an American fantasy author who produced a number of books in the 1980s and early 1990s.

He becomes obsessed with the notorious socialite Evelyn Nesbit, stalking her and embarking on a brief, unsatisfactory affair with her. Mother's Younger Brother is a genius at explosives and fireworks but is an insecure, unhappy character who chases after love and excitement. Father joins Robert Peary's expedition to the North Pole, and his return sees a change in his relationship with his wife, who has experienced independence in his absence. The family business is the manufacture of flags and fireworks, an easy source of wealth due to the national enthusiasm for patriotic displays. The novel centers on a wealthy family living in New Rochelle, New York, referred to as Father, Mother, Mother's Younger Brother, Grandfather, and 'the little boy', Father and Mother's young son. TIME included the novel in its TIME 100 Best English-Language Novels from 1923 to 2005. In 1998, the Modern Library ranked Ragtime number 86 on its list of the 100 best English-language novels of the 20th century. It is a work of historical fiction mainly set in the New York City area from 1902 until 1912. The part made Fox a major television star, with three consecutive (1986, 1987, 1988) Emmy Awards for outstanding lead actor in a comedy series, as well as nominations in 19. Keaton's cute, preppy Republicanism contrasted sharply with the values of his hippy parents but was in tune with then-president Ronald Reagan Keaton in what turned out to be the popular and long-running NBC TV series Family Ties (1982–89). Pollard.) He was days away from returning to Vancouver when he landed the part of Alex P. (Reluctant to use his middle initial “A” due to the double meaning it leant his name - “Michael, a fox!” - he instead used a J as an homage to character actor Michael J. In 1979 he landed a role in Letters from Frank, his first movie made for American television, and in 1980 he had a leading role in the Disney-produced Midnight Madness.įox moved to Los Angeles to pursue a career in television, and added the letter J as his middle initial when it became necessary to distinguish himself from another Michael Fox listed in the American Screen Actors directory. At age 12 he appeared in an episode of The Beachcombers and at 15 he starred alongside Brent Carver in the short-lived CBC sitcom Leo and Me, shot in Vancouver. Michael Fox, the son of an army dispatcher, moved among various towns until his father retired and the family settled in Burnaby, British Columbia, in the early 1970s. Take the self-guided tour along San Pablo Avenue to visit the pavers and learn about El Cerrito's history and culture. Each paver depicts an element of the City's historic and/or cultural heritage. The goal of the project is to identify El Cerrito as a distinct place along the Avenue, enhance the economic vitality of the area, and create a better walking environment.Īs a part of making San Pablo Avenue a more inviting walking corridor, the City installed 28 interpretive sidewalk pavers at various locations along the Avenue. In 2011, the City completed a comprehensive project to enhance San Pablo Avenue. Winter Sleep awakens to a literally incendiary climax.
